S4 vs S5 Fuel lines

Im been searching for a little bit now and can't find much info on the fuel lines in each car, I'm swapping all the parts from my S5 to a S4 including the fuel tank since the shell didn't have one, Are the lines different sizes on the S4 then the S5? I believe the tank is a little larger on the S5 but it seems to be close enough to fit.

Mazda shows the same part number, S4 and S5. the vert and coupe are different, but it is probably something minor
